Que es responsiva estructural

En el ámbito del diseño web y la arquitectura digital, el término responsiva estructural se refiere a una metodología que permite que los diseños se adapten dinámicamente a diferentes dispositivos y resoluciones de pantalla. Este enfoque no solo mejora la experiencia del usuario, sino que también garantiza que el contenido se muestre de manera clara y funcional en cualquier dispositivo, desde móviles hasta monitores de escritorio.

¿Qué es responsiva estructural?

La responsiva estructural, también conocida como diseño responsivo estructural, es una técnica utilizada en el desarrollo web que asegura que las páginas web se ajusten automáticamente al tamaño del dispositivo en el que se ven. Esto se logra mediante el uso de herramientas como CSS media queries, flexbox, grid layouts y fuentes escalables, entre otros.

El objetivo principal de esta técnica es brindar una experiencia coherente y agradable al usuario, independientemente de si está navegando desde un teléfono inteligente, una tableta o una computadora de escritorio. La responsiva estructural no solo afecta la apariencia visual, sino también la funcionalidad y la accesibilidad del contenido.

Un dato curioso es que el concepto de diseño responsivo fue introducido por primera vez en el año 2008 por Ethan Marcotte, quien acuñó el término en su artículo Responsive Web Design. Desde entonces, se ha convertido en un estándar esencial en el desarrollo web moderno. Hoy en día, Google incluso premia a las páginas responsivas en sus algoritmos de búsqueda, favoreciendo a las que ofrecen una experiencia móvil optimizada.

También te puede interesar

El impacto del diseño responsivo en la experiencia del usuario

El diseño responsivo estructural no solo afecta la apariencia de una página web, sino que también influye profundamente en la experiencia del usuario (UX). Un sitio web que no se adapte correctamente a diferentes dispositivos puede resultar frustrante para el visitante, lo que a su vez puede llevar a una mayor tasa de rebote y a una menor conversión.

Una de las ventajas más importantes del diseño responsivo estructural es que elimina la necesidad de crear versiones separadas para móviles, tablets y escritorios. Esto significa que los desarrolladores pueden trabajar con una sola base de código, lo cual ahorra tiempo y recursos. Además, desde el punto de vista del usuario, no hay necesidad de redirigir a diferentes dominios según el dispositivo, lo que mejora la coherencia y la percepción de marca.

Otra ventaja es la mejora en el posicionamiento SEO. Google ha declarado oficialmente que prefiere los sitios web responsivos sobre los que tienen versiones separadas para móviles. Esto significa que al implementar un diseño responsivo estructural, no solo se mejora la experiencia del usuario, sino también el rendimiento en los motores de búsqueda.

La responsiva estructural en la arquitectura física

Aunque el término responsiva estructural es más común en el ámbito digital, también se puede aplicar de forma metafórica a la arquitectura física. En este contexto, se refiere a estructuras que pueden adaptarse a diferentes condiciones ambientales o cargas sin perder su funcionalidad o estabilidad.

Por ejemplo, edificios con estructuras flexibles diseñadas para soportar terremotos son un claro ejemplo de responsividad estructural en arquitectura. Estos diseños permiten que la estructura absorba movimientos súbitos, redistribuyendo la energía para evitar daños significativos. Este tipo de enfoque ha ganado popularidad en zonas sísmicas como Japón o Chile, donde la seguridad ante desastres naturales es un factor crítico.

Ejemplos de diseño responsivo estructural

Para entender mejor cómo funciona el diseño responsivo estructural, veamos algunos ejemplos prácticos:

  • Grid Layouts responsivos: Usando CSS Grid, los desarrolladores pueden crear diseños que se reorganizan automáticamente según el tamaño de la pantalla. Por ejemplo, una página que muestra tres columnas en escritorio puede cambiar a una sola columna en móviles.
  • Flexbox: Esta herramienta permite que los elementos dentro de una página se ajusten dinámicamente, manteniendo un equilibrio visual en cualquier dispositivo.
  • Media Queries: Con estas reglas de CSS, los desarrolladores pueden aplicar estilos diferentes según el tamaño de la pantalla. Por ejemplo, ocultar menús de navegación en móviles y reemplazarlos con iconos de menú hamburguesa.
  • Imágenes responsivas: Las imágenes se ajustan automáticamente al tamaño de la pantalla, usando atributos como `srcset` y `sizes`, lo cual mejora tanto la experiencia visual como el rendimiento de la página.

Concepto de responsividad estructural en diseño web

La responsividad estructural se basa en el concepto de flexibilidad y adaptabilidad, dos principios esenciales en el diseño moderno. En lugar de crear diseños rígidos que solo funcionan bien en ciertos dispositivos, esta metodología permite que el contenido se reorganice de manera inteligente, manteniendo siempre su legibilidad y usabilidad.

Este concepto también se aplica a la tipografía y los espaciados. Por ejemplo, el tamaño de las fuentes puede ajustarse automáticamente dependiendo del dispositivo, asegurando que el texto sea legible sin necesidad de acercar o alejar la pantalla. Además, los espaciados entre elementos también se adaptan, lo cual mejora la legibilidad y la navegación.

Un ejemplo práctico es el uso de unidades relativas como `%`, `em`, o `rem`, que permiten que los elementos se escalen proporcionalmente. Esto es fundamental para lograr una experiencia coherente en cualquier pantalla.

5 herramientas esenciales para el diseño responsivo estructural

  • Bootstrap: Un framework de CSS muy popular que facilita el diseño responsivo gracias a su grid sistema y componentes predefinidos.
  • Foundation: Otra alternativa a Bootstrap, con un enfoque más flexible y personalizable.
  • CSS Grid y Flexbox: Herramientas nativas de CSS que permiten crear diseños responsivos sin necesidad de frameworks.
  • Adobe XD y Figma: Herramientas de diseño que permiten prototipar diseños responsivos y simular cómo se ven en diferentes dispositivos.
  • Google Lighthouse: Una herramienta de auditoría que evalúa la responsividad de una página web y ofrece recomendaciones para mejorarla.

Ventajas del diseño responsivo estructural en el desarrollo web

Una de las principales ventajas del diseño responsivo estructural es la optimización de recursos. Al contar con una única URL y un solo código base, los desarrolladores ahorran tiempo y dinero en el mantenimiento del sitio web. Además, esto facilita la actualización del contenido, ya que no es necesario modificar versiones separadas para cada dispositivo.

Otra ventaja clave es la mejora en el posicionamiento SEO. Google ha anunciado oficialmente que los sitios web responsivos son preferidos en los resultados de búsqueda, especialmente en dispositivos móviles. Esto se debe a que ofrecen una experiencia más coherente y directa al usuario, sin redirecciones ni versiones separadas.

¿Para qué sirve el diseño responsivo estructural?

El diseño responsivo estructural sirve, principalmente, para garantizar una experiencia de usuario uniforme independientemente del dispositivo desde el cual se acceda a una página web. Su funcionalidad incluye:

  • Ajustar el diseño de la página según el tamaño de la pantalla.
  • Optimizar la navegación para dispositivos móviles.
  • Mejorar la velocidad de carga y la accesibilidad.
  • Facilitar el mantenimiento del sitio web.
  • Mejorar el posicionamiento en los motores de búsqueda.

En el mundo de las empresas, el diseño responsivo estructural también es fundamental para mantener una presencia digital coherente y profesional, lo cual es clave para la confianza del cliente.

Sinónimos y variantes del diseño responsivo estructural

Aunque diseño responsivo estructural es el término más común, existen otras formas de referirse a esta metodología:

  • Responsive Web Design (RWD): El nombre en inglés del diseño responsivo.
  • Diseño adaptativo: Una variante en la que se crean versiones específicas para diferentes dispositivos.
  • Mobile-first: Un enfoque en el cual el diseño comienza desde la perspectiva de los dispositivos móviles.
  • Diseño fluido: Un enfoque en el cual los elementos se ajustan proporcionalmente al tamaño de la pantalla.

Cada una de estas variantes tiene sus pros y contras, y la elección depende de las necesidades específicas del proyecto.

El futuro del diseño responsivo estructural

Con el crecimiento exponencial del uso de dispositivos móviles, el diseño responsivo estructural no solo es una tendencia, sino una necesidad absoluta. Según datos de Statista, más del 50% del tráfico web proviene de dispositivos móviles, lo que reafirma la importancia de una experiencia web optimizada.

En el futuro, se espera que el diseño responsivo se integre más profundamente con otras tecnologías como IA generativa, AR/VR y dispositivos wearables, lo cual exigirá aún más flexibilidad y adaptabilidad en los diseños web. Además, con el auge de la web progresiva (PWA), el diseño responsivo estructural se convertirá en una pieza clave para ofrecer experiencias web ricas y offline.

El significado de responsiva estructural

El término responsiva estructural se compone de dos partes clave:

  • Responsiva: Hace referencia a la capacidad de adaptarse a diferentes condiciones o estímulos.
  • Estructural: Se refiere a la organización y disposición de los elementos que conforman un sistema o diseño.

Juntos, estos términos describen un enfoque de diseño que permite que los elementos de una página web se reorganicen y adapten dinámicamente al dispositivo que los visualiza. Esto incluye la disposición de contenido, el tamaño de los elementos y la navegación.

Otro aspecto importante del diseño responsivo estructural es su enfoque en la usabilidad, lo cual implica que el contenido debe ser fácil de leer, navegar y acceder, independientemente del dispositivo utilizado. Esto se logra mediante técnicas como el diseño en capas, donde se prioriza el contenido esencial en dispositivos móviles y se amplía con elementos adicionales en pantallas más grandes.

¿Cuál es el origen del término responsiva estructural?

El término responsiva estructural como tal no se popularizó de inmediato. Su uso comenzó a difundirse a partir de la publicación del artículo de Ethan Marcotte en 2008, donde introdujo el concepto de diseño responsivo. En ese momento, el objetivo era resolver el problema de la fragmentación entre versiones móviles y de escritorio de las páginas web.

A medida que los dispositivos móviles se volvían más comunes, la necesidad de un enfoque único que adaptara el diseño a cualquier pantalla se hacía evidente. Así surgió el término responsivo estructural como una forma de describir el proceso mediante el cual los elementos de una página web se reorganizan para ofrecer una experiencia óptima.

El término ha evolucionado con el tiempo, y hoy en día se utiliza para describir no solo el diseño, sino también el desarrollo y la estructura técnica detrás de una página web adaptable.

Otras formas de llamar al diseño responsivo estructural

Además de responsiva estructural, se pueden encontrar otros términos que describen el mismo concepto:

  • Responsive Web Design (RWD): El nombre original en inglés.
  • Diseño adaptable: Un término que se usa cuando el diseño se ajusta a condiciones específicas.
  • Mobile-friendly: Se usa comúnmente en contextos SEO para describir sitios optimizados para móviles.
  • Diseño flexible: Enfatiza la capacidad de los elementos para ajustarse dinámicamente.

Cada uno de estos términos puede tener matices ligeramente diferentes, pero todos apuntan a la misma idea: ofrecer una experiencia web coherente y adaptada a cualquier dispositivo.

¿Cómo se implementa el diseño responsivo estructural?

La implementación del diseño responsivo estructural implica varios pasos y herramientas clave:

  • HTML Semántico: Usar etiquetas HTML que describan correctamente el contenido, lo que facilita la adaptación.
  • CSS Media Queries: Aplicar estilos diferentes según el tamaño de la pantalla.
  • Flexbox y Grid: Usar estos sistemas de diseño para organizar el contenido de manera flexible.
  • Imágenes responsivas: Usar atributos como `srcset` y `sizes` para que las imágenes se ajusten al dispositivo.
  • Testing en múltiples dispositivos: Usar herramientas como Google Chrome DevTools para simular diferentes resoluciones y dispositivos.

Este enfoque asegura que el diseño no solo se vea bien, sino que también funcione correctamente en cualquier dispositivo.

Cómo usar el diseño responsivo estructural y ejemplos de uso

Para usar el diseño responsivo estructural, es fundamental seguir una metodología clara:

  • Mobile-first: Empezar el diseño desde la perspectiva de los dispositivos móviles y luego ampliar para pantallas más grandes.
  • Uso de breakpoints: Establecer puntos de ruptura donde el diseño cambia su estructura según el tamaño de la pantalla.
  • Diseño flexible: Asegurar que los elementos no tengan tamaños fijos, sino que se adapten proporcionalmente.

Un ejemplo práctico es el uso de grillas responsivas en una página de e-commerce. En escritorio, se pueden mostrar 4 productos por fila, pero en móviles, se ajusta a 1 producto por fila para mejorar la legibilidad.

Errores comunes al implementar el diseño responsivo estructural

A pesar de su popularidad, el diseño responsivo estructural puede presentar desafíos. Algunos errores comunes incluyen:

  • No usar breakpoints adecuados: Establecer puntos de ruptura en lugares incorrectos puede hacer que el diseño se vea mal en ciertos dispositivos.
  • Ignorar la velocidad de carga: Un diseño responsivo puede afectar negativamente el rendimiento si no se optimizan imágenes y recursos.
  • No probar en dispositivos reales: Aunque las herramientas de simulación son útiles, nada reemplaza probar en dispositivos físicos.
  • Sobrecargar el diseño: Añadir demasiados elementos responsivos puede complicar la navegación y afectar la usabilidad.

Evitar estos errores requiere una planificación cuidadosa y una implementación bien ejecutada.

Tendencias futuras del diseño responsivo estructural

El futuro del diseño responsivo estructural apunta hacia una mayor integración con tecnologías emergentes, como:

  • Diseño responsivo para dispositivos wearables como relojes inteligentes y gafas de realidad aumentada.
  • Experiencias web progresivas (PWA): Que permiten que las páginas web se comporten como aplicaciones nativas.
  • Diseño responsivo basado en IA: Donde los algoritmos ajustan automáticamente el diseño según el comportamiento del usuario.

Estas tendencias refuerzan la importancia del diseño responsivo estructural como una metodología esencial para el desarrollo web moderno.